Drinks like mineral water and certain fortified beverages can be high in magnesium. Some plant-based milks are also fortified with magnesium.

Magnesium can contribute to skin health and may play a role in other aspects of beauty such as hair and nail strength.

Magnesium has been shown to help relax muscles and improve sleep quality, so it may make some people feel sleepy.

Magnesium may help improve skin hydration and reduce inflammation, although more research is needed.

There's no strong evidence to suggest it's either good or bad for acne; its effects can vary from person to person.

It's generally recommended to take magnesium gummies in the evening to improve sleep, but consult a healthcare provider for personalized advice.

Taking magnesium at night may help improve sleep quality due to its muscle-relaxing properties.

Some people report feeling effects within a few hours, but it may take longer for others.

At-home testing kits are available, but they are not as reliable as a blood test administered by a healthcare provider.

The effects can vary from person to person, but some users report feeling calmer and more relaxed within a few hours.
